Cloud service models define how your applications, platforms, and infrastructure are built, managed, and scaled. Our cloud architects help you choose the right mix of IaaS, PaaS, SaaS, containers, serverless, and managed cloud services based on your workloads, compliance needs, cost goals, AI readiness, and product roadmap.
We build secure, scalable cloud environments using Infrastructure-as-a-Service (IaaS), giving you greater control over compute, storage, networking, and workloads. IaaS is ideal for businesses that need custom infrastructure, legacy modernization, high-performance applications, GPU compute for AI workloads, or stronger control over cloud architecture and security.
Our cloud engineers use Platform-as-a-Service to speed up cloud application development without managing the underlying infrastructure. PaaS helps your teams build, test, deploy, and scale applications faster using ready-made development environments, databases, middleware, cloud-native AI services, and managed platforms such as Azure OpenAI or AWS Bedrock.

Cloud deployment models define where your workloads run and how infrastructure is controlled. Our cloud architects help you choose public, private, hybrid, or multi-cloud environments based on performance, compliance, cost, data access, user needs, AI readiness, and operational flexibility.
We design and deploy public cloud environments for businesses that need faster scalability, flexible infrastructure, and lower upfront costs. Our cloud architects help you build SaaS platforms, customer-facing apps, analytics dashboards, automation workflows, and AI-enabled digital products that can scale with changing traffic and business demand.
We build private cloud environments for businesses that need stronger control over sensitive data, access policies, compliance, and infrastructure. Our cloud engineers help you create secure, governed cloud systems for regulated industries, internal platforms, financial applications, healthcare systems, private AI workloads, and business-critical applications.
We connect your existing infrastructure with modern cloud environments so you can modernize gradually without disrupting critical operations. Our cloud engineers help integrate legacy systems, private workloads, cloud applications, data platforms, and AI-ready infrastructure while balancing scalability, security, and continuity.
We design multi-cloud strategies that reduce vendor lock-in, improve resilience, and place workloads where they perform best. Our cloud architects help you use AWS, Azure, and Google Cloud for better availability, backup, regional performance, service flexibility, cloud cost optimization, and GenAI infrastructure planning.
